Hyderabad: Natco Pharma Ltd on Friday posted a 9% fall in net profit in the quarter ended 30 September due to declining sales of active pharmaceutical ingredients.
The company reported a net profit of ₹ 29.6 crore in the three months compared with ₹ 32.4 crore in the year-ago period. Sales rose 7.2% to ₹ 235 crore.
Sales of generic drugs, which contribute about three-fourths of sales, grew 34% to ₹ 159 crore from ₹ 119 crore in the year-ago period. Sales of active pharmaceutical ingredients, the key raw materials that go into the manufacture of drugs, declined 30% to ₹ 52 crore.
Its operating profit margin declined 252 basis points year-on-year to 24.9% against ICICIdirect estimate of 26%, mainly on account of an increase in employee expenses, ICICIdirect said.
One basis point is one-hundredth of a percentage point.
